A kind of reliable LED illumination lamp
Technical field
The present invention relates to LED technical field, specifically a kind of reliable LED illumination lamp.
Background technology
Most of LED illumination lamp of the prior art is no electrocution-proof protection structure, user change lamp holder or It is when repairing light fixture and the easy contact touched in bulb socket, so as to cause to get an electric shock, triggers accident, produces the person and property and damage Lose, and existing LED illumination lamp is typically fixed together by fasteners such as screws, it is necessary to utilize spiral shell during installation Power supply and Lighting Division are installed together by the instruments such as silk knife;When LED illumination lamp breaks down, it is necessary to utilize screwdriver etc. Instrument takes power supply and Lighting Division apart, causes installation and removal consuming time length, operating efficiency low, it is impossible to meet existing need Will.

During original state, top pressure active force of the movable block 836 by the first spring 8352 so that the bottom end of movable block 836 Face is abutted against with the inner bottom wall of the first chute 833, now, the first contact pin 8361 away from power supply hole 837, meanwhile, sliding shoe 842 by The top pressure active force of second spring 846 so that sliding shoe 842 is located at the most inner side of sliding chamber 841, and now, inclined-plane closing piece 843 is by most The top pressure of big degree enters in holding tank 82, meanwhile, the inner side of rotation regulating part 847 and the lateral wall of housing 81 are abutted against, and rotation is adjusted Section part 847 is abutted against away from the side of housing 81 with limited block 845.
When needing to install and use, lower lamp body 7 is moved to the lower section of upper lamp body 8 first, and makes the top of connecting rod 72 with holding The bottom of groove 82 is received in relative position, lower lamp body 7 is promoted then up so that holding tank 82 is gradually stretched at the top of connecting rod 72 It is interior, meanwhile, connect the bottom of block 83 and gradually stretch into inserting groove 74, until guiding incline 76 as shown in Figure 4 offsets with inclined-plane closing piece 843 Connect, continue up the lower lamp body 7 of promotion, slided by guiding incline 76 and inclined-plane closing piece 843 and compress cooperation so that inclined-plane closing piece 843 Sliding shoe 842 is driven to overcome the top pressure active force retraction of second spring 846 to slide in chamber 841, meanwhile, positioning pushes to slide block 75 and gradually stretched Enter in the second chute 831 and be slidably matched, the lower lamp body 7 of promotion is continued up, until the inner side end of inclined-plane closing piece 843 and connecting rod 72 outer walls slide against cooperation, now, the lower lamp body 7 of promotion are continued up, until positioning pushes to slide block 75 and movable block as shown in Figure 5 836 abut against, and then proceed to push up lower lamp body 7 so that positioning pushes to slide block 75 and drives movable block 836 to overcome the first spring 8352 pressure on top surface is gradually moved up along guide rod 8351, until in the top end face of connecting rod 72 as shown in Figure 6 and holding tank 82 Roof is abutted against, now, and the top end face of movable block 836 is abutted against with the inner roof wall of the first chute 833, meanwhile, the first contact pin 8361 In fully-inserted power supply hole 837, the inner bottom wall of inserting groove 74 is abutted against with connecting the bottom end face of block 83, meanwhile, the second inserted link 78 is complete It is fully inserted into conductive hole 832, the top end face of collet 71 is abutted against with the bottom end face of housing 81, meanwhile, inclined-plane closing piece 843 passes through The top pressure active force of two springs 846 is slipped into lock hole 77, now completes to install, in the fully-inserted conductive hole of the second inserted link 78 In 832, when the top end face of collet 71 is abutted against with the bottom end face of housing 81, sealing strip 108, which is also inserted into seal groove 107, to be coordinated To play sealed effect, the sealing after installing that cooperated between lamp body 8 and lower lamp body 7 is added;Maintenance is needed to tear open When unloading, by rotating twisting rotation regulating part 847 so that the drive sliding shoe 842 of screw rod 844 overcomes the top pressure of second spring 846 Active force retraction is slided in chamber 841, is now pulled downward on lower lamp body 7 and is completed dismounting, and rotation regulating part is reversely twisted after the completion of dismounting 847 make rotation regulating part 847 be abutted against with limited block 845, so as to realize reuse.
